
Mr India was originally conceived for Amitabh Bachchan before Salim-Javed's split, Javed Akhtar reveals: ‘I developed it completely on my own'
Recalling how the idea was sparked, he said that during a film's muhurat (launch), that was to be done by Amitabh Bachchan, the actor was not available in person. So, it was decided that his voice would be played at the muhurat. 'He had to do the mahurat, and because of some reason, they recorded the voice of Amitabh and played it during the muhurat shot. So, that gave me an idea — if this voice is so popular, so effective, why can't we make the Invisible Man with him? We wouldn't have to take his dates also. Most of the time, we could shoot and he would later dub his voice… That is how the idea started,' he shared.
He also recalled how he wanted to weave in a children's emotional angle, believing kids would be fascinated by the idea of an invisible man. However, the idea came to a halt after his professional split with longtime writing partner Salim Khan.
Returning to the development of Mr India, Javed recalled writing the story, screenplay, and dialogue on his own — but initially, there were no takers. 'I developed it completely on my own, wrote the screenplay, dialogue. People were like, 'Arey invisible man… arey ye effect… yeh iss tarah ki films thodi chalti hai… it's a gimmick… woh thodi hit hoti hai… pehli bani Mr X, Ashok Kumar was the hero… then Mr X in Bombay… itna badi hit nahi hoti aisi films.'' (People said, 'Oh, invisible man… these kinds of effects… these kinds of films don't usually work, it's a gimmick… they get a little popular, that's it… there was Mr. X with Ashok Kumar, then Mr. X in Bombay, films like these never become major hits).
However, things changed when producer Boney Kapoor came onboard. According to Javed, Boney liked the concept and wanted to use it to launch his younger brother Anil Kapoor alongside a big-name actress — which finally got the film off the ground.

Javed said that many believed that the reason behind his split with Salim Khan was his closeness with Amitabh Bachchan, but that wasn't the case, which is why he stayed away from working with Big B for the next decade. 'Many people thought, because I was very friendly with Amitabh Bachchan, because I was closer to him, so I parted because of that. So for the next ten years, I didn't do any film with Amitabh Bachchan. I had some offers, but I didn't take them because I didn't want this tag on me that I broke this partnership because of some support,' he said.
In the book titled 'Written by Salim-Javed: The Story of Hindi Cinema's Greatest Screenwriters' by Diptakirti Chaudhuri, this incident is revisited in detail. As per the author, Salim Khan gave a lengthy interview to journalist Anita Padhye for her Marathi book 'Yahi Rang, Yahi Roop' where he spoke about the same. He shared that the director duo presented this idea to Amitabh but the Sholay actor wasn't keen on it. Apparently, Bachchan believed that the invisible-man concept wouldn't work as his fans came to the theatres to see him. The writers believed that Bachchan's voice would be the star of the show, and as per him, this triggered the end of their writing partnership.

Amitabh Bachchan Hails S. Jaishankar On KBC 17: 'He Speaks Like An Army Officer'
Amitabh Bachchan praised External Affairs Minister S. Jaishankar on the Independence Day special of Kaun Banega Crorepati. On the occasion of Independence Day, Kaun Banega Crorepati offered its audience a powerful gift with a special episode titled Independence Day Maha Utsav. The show brought together three fearless women officers from the Indian Army, Navy, and Air Force who had played crucial roles in Operation Sindoor, a mission that dealt a strong response to Pakistan. The patriotic episode wasn't just filled with quiz questions but also with moments of respect, inspiration, and pride. One such moment came when host and megastar Amitabh Bachchan praised India's External Affairs Minister, Dr. S. Jaishankar, drawing parallels between his commanding diplomatic style and that of an Army officer. 'Tough Talk, Like a Soldier" During a round of questions that began directly from the sixth level, the contestants were shown a picture of former External Affairs Ministers Salman Khurshid and the late Sushma Swaraj. They were then asked to identify the next minister in sequence. The officers confidently answered: Dr. S. Jaishankar. Reacting with a smile, Amitabh Bachchan admitted that he often watches Jaishankar's interviews and is deeply impressed by his manner of speaking. 'He speaks so strongly and with such authority that it feels like he could easily be in the Army," Bachchan said. This candid remark instantly became the most talked-about moment of the episode, with viewers applauding the megastar for acknowledging Jaishankar's firm and fearless presence on the global stage. Fans on social media even hailed it as proof of India's diplomatic strength and Jaishankar's growing popularity. Heroes of Operation Sindoor Adding to the patriotic fervour were the three officers who graced the stage: Colonel Sophia Qureshi (Army), known for her exemplary service during United Nations missions. Wing Commander Vyomika Singh (Air Force), celebrated for her daring spirit in the skies. Commander Prerna Devasthali (Navy), who thrives on the challenges of the sea. These officers were instrumental in Operation Sindoor, where they played decisive roles against Pakistan. Their entry was welcomed with a standing ovation from the audience and from Amitabh Bachchan himself, reflecting the immense pride the nation feels for its women warriors. Janhvi Kapoor Goes 'Wow Papa' As Boney Kapoor Flaunts New Haircut; Orry Calls Him 'Dashing'
Last Updated: Janhvi Kapoor admired her father, Boney Kapoor, as he posed in old jeans and a new haircut. The actor will be next seen in Param Sundari. Actress Janhvi Kapoor couldn't stop admiring her father, Boney Kapoor, as he posed in a 22-year-old altered jeans, an 18-year-old shirt, and a fresh haircut. The producer was seen wearing a blue checkered shirt, paired with blue denim and matching loafers. He also flaunted extremely short hair as part of his new look. As Boney dropped some photos of his latest avatar on social media, daughter Janhvi reacted by writing 'Wow papa" in the comment section, along with four red heart emojis. View this post on Instagram A post shared by (@ On Wednesday, Boney marked his late wife Sridevi's 62nd birth anniversary by taking a trip down memory lane. He shared a cherished memory from 1990, when the legendary actress mistook one of his compliments for teasing. Boney took to his official Instagram handle, where he dropped an old picture from Sridevi's 27th birthday. He disclosed that at her birthday party in Chennai, he wished Sridevi a 'happy 26th birthday" on purpose, which she misunderstood and thought he was teasing her. Explaining the incident, Boney wrote: 'In 1990 her birthday party in chennai when I wished her happy 26th birthday while it was her 27th birthday to make her feel that she had gone younger & it was a compliment , that with every passing day she is getting younger but she taught (thought) I was teasing her." Boney frequently treats the netizens with old photographs of Sridevi and shares anecdotes about their fond memories. For those who do not know, Boney and Sridevi fell for one another on the sets of the 1987 film 'Mr. India". After dating for some time, the couple tied the knot back in 1996. They were blessed with two daughters – Janhvi and Khushi Kapoor. Shah Rukh Khan Gives MAJOR Update On King: ‘Insha Allah Will Be Done Fast'
Shah Rukh Khan's witty reply during #AskSRK wins fans! The superstar revealed an update on his next film King with Suhana Khan, assuring fans that shooting will resume soon. Shah Rukh Khan, last seen in Dunki, has left his fans eagerly awaiting his next big-screen outing. The superstar is set to headline King, a high-octane action thriller where he stars alongside his daughter Suhana Khan. The film, already touted as one of the most ambitious projects of his career, has now hit a slight roadblock due to health concerns. During his trademark #AskSRK session on X (formerly Twitter), a fan asked him when his next film would release. In his witty yet candid response, SRK wrote, 'Did some good shoot… starting soon again. Only leg shots then move to upper body… Insha Allah will be done fast. @justSidAnand is working hard to finish." While his optimism reassured fans, reports indicate that King's production schedule has been temporarily affected by the actor's recent injury. Did some good shoot….starting soon again. Only leg shots then move to upper body….Insha Allah will be done fast. @justSidAnand is working hard to finish. — Shah Rukh Khan (@iamsrk) August 16, 2025 According to Mid-Day, the filming has been delayed after SRK sustained a shoulder strain while shooting an intense action sequence at Golden Tobacco Studio in Mumbai. Sources close to the production revealed that although the injury is not life-threatening, it required medical attention abroad. SRK has since flown to the United States for precautionary treatment, and doctors have reportedly advised him to take at least a month's break. The disruption has forced the makers to pause schedules that were originally lined up at Film City, Golden Tobacco, and YRF Studios through July and August. The next phase of shooting is expected to resume around September or October, depending on his recovery. Despite the delay, expectations from King remain sky-high. The film sees SRK as a seasoned assassin operating within the dark underworld, while Suhana plays his protégé, training for dangerous missions. The ensemble cast includes Deepika Padukone, Anil Kapoor, Rani Mukerji, Arshad Warsi, Abhay Verma, and Raghav Juyal. Anil Kapoor reportedly essays the role of SRK's mentor and handler, guiding him through the perilous world of espionage. With international stunt coordinators on board, King promises edge-of-the-seat action on par with global blockbusters. Though unconfirmed, industry reports hint at a possible 2027 release window.
